What affects the price

When you are budgeting for drywall work, several factors determine the final bill. The total square footage is the biggest driver, but the complexity of the space matters just as much. High ceilings, intricate corners, and multiple levels require more labor and specialized equipment. If you need repairs, the size and depth of the hole, plus the difficulty of matching existing textures, change the scope. About this service

This is the standard thickness used for most interior walls and ceilings in homes today. It provides a good balance of durability and ease of installation for typical residential framing. How do you approach a drywall hole repair in Houston?

Repairing a drywall hole in Houston depends on the size. For small punctures, the pros will typically patch it with a new piece of drywall and multiple thin coats of joint compound. They'll sand it smooth and match the existing texture. Larger holes require more structural support and larger patches. The goal is always to make the repair invisible.

What's involved in mudding drywall for Houston homes?

Mudding drywall in Houston involves applying joint compound (mud) over seams, screws, and patches. The pros apply it in multiple thin coats, allowing each to dry thoroughly before sanding. This process builds up to a smooth, flat surface ready for paint. Proper mudding is key to a professional finish that hides all imperfections. It’s where the real magic happens for a flawless wall.

Can drywall spackle be used for larger repairs in Houston?

Drywall spackle is best suited for very small holes and cosmetic touch-ups in Houston. For larger damage, professionals recommend using joint compound, as it provides better adhesion and durability. Spackle can shrink and crack on bigger jobs. The pros you'll speak with will determine the best material for a lasting repair. They know what works best for your walls.
